How to configure the BLF function with Yealink IP Phones
Note: Before your can use Presence/BLF, an account Administrator must first book the tariff sipgate business L or sipgate business XL.
This guide describes the setup of sipgate team Presence (BLF) with Yealink T26P, T28P and T46G phones. Yealink T20P and T22P don't have BLF functionality. Using the instructions in your device manual, please login to the Web Configuration Menu of your Yealink.
Tap the ok button on your Yealink phone to display the IP address of your phone. The IP address looks like this, for example: 192.168.0.1
Add User for the BLF
Enter the IP address in the address bar of your browser. You will now see the configuration interface of your telephone. Use the menu to switch to the Dsskey ➔ Line key 1-11 area. You can now enter the data as shown below in the following window.
Please click on DSSKey and then choose the Line Keys option in the lefthand sidebar.
- Type: select BLF;
- Value: Enter your colleagues' extensions, e.g. use 42 to see the status of the user with extension 42;
- Line: choose the Line you've setup with your sipgate team account;
- Extension: please enter a meaningful value e.g. your colleague's name.
To make sure your changes take effect, please click Confirm.
